Mallory Rubin and Jason Concepcion continue their exploration of the Harry Potter universe by diving deep into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ows, chapters 34-35. To help guide you on that journey, here is a map of the 60th episode of Binge Mode: Harry Potter. It’s not quite as detailed as the Marauder’s Map, but don’t fear: The podcast is just as magical.

  1. Mallory and Jason start their journey, of course, on the Hogwarts Express, providing a brief refresher on what happened in these two chapters. Harry discovers the Resurrection Stone gifted to him by Dumbledore, walks into the Forbidden Forest to sacrifice himself, and ends up in King’s Cross station, where Dumbledore waits and explains all the secrets at last.
  2. They continue by diving into the Pensieve, where they analyze the central theme of this section of the book: sacrifice.
  3. Next, they sneak into the Restricted Section so Mallory can teach us everything we need to know about King’s Cross.
  4. After reemerging from that section of the library, Mallory and Jason discuss the Seven, where they share their seven favorite insights and observations from this swath of chapters. Here, they examine the process of writing “The Forbidden Forest,” some Horcrux minutiae, and more.
  5. Finally, they award the House Cup to a worthy winner of the two chapters. This episode’s recipient is Harry Potter, for completing the most phenomenal stretch of heroism in the entire series.
